Automotive Special Purpose Logic IC Market Concentration & Dynamics
This section delves into the competitive landscape of the Automotive Special Purpose Logic IC market. The market exhibits a moderately concentrated structure, with the top five players holding an estimated xx% market share in 2025. Innovation within the ecosystem is driven by the need for higher processing speeds, improved power efficiency, and enhanced safety features in vehicles. Stringent regulatory frameworks, particularly concerning automotive safety and emissions, are shaping product development and adoption. Substitute products, such as microcontrollers and programmable logic devices, exert some competitive pressure. However, the unique functionalities and performance characteristics of special purpose logic ICs maintain their dominance in specific applications. End-user trends, such as the increasing adoption of advanced driver-assistance systems (ADAS) and autonomous driving technologies, are fueling market growth. The number of M&A activities in the sector has been steadily increasing, with xx deals recorded between 2019 and 2024, indicating consolidation and strategic expansion within the industry. These mergers and acquisitions often focus on enhancing technological capabilities and expanding market reach.

Key Milestones in Automotive Special Purpose Logic IC Market Industry
- June 2021: TSMC upgraded its N5 semiconductor technology for automotive applications (N5A), offering a 20% performance boost, 40% power efficiency increase, and 80% logic density improvement compared to N7.
- January 2022: Samsung launched three new automotive solutions: Exynos Auto T5123, Exynos Auto V7, and S2VPS01, aimed at enhancing 5G connectivity and safety.
